Benefits of a Bio Ethanol Fireplace

Consider a bio-ethanol fire place if you want an authentic flame and heat, but don't require a chimney or flue. It's safe to use so provided you adhere to basic guidelines. Be sure to use only the e-NRG liquid ethanol fuel, and don't add any other substances to the burner.

No chimney or flue

Unlike a traditional wood-burning fireplace that requires a chimney and flue, a bio ethanol fire does not require this. It can be put in any room in your home, and does not require structural changes. It's also less expensive than running conventional gas fires.

The majority of bio-ethanol fireplaces feature an adjustable burner that allows you to regulate the size of the flame. This allows you to efficiently heat your room and efficiently. You can also use a false flue to give your fireplace an authentic look if you like.

Ethanol Fireplaces are secure and easy to set up, and do not emit smoke, ash, or carbon monoxide. However, it is important to keep in mind that bio-ethanol fires should not be used near any flammable object. Keeping flammable materials and supplies at least 1500mm away from your fireplace is recommended to minimise the chance of accidental fire. It is also important to never place combustible objects over your fire. This could cause the flame to rise and then burn any combustible objects that are beneath it.

A litre of fuel can last for 3 hours at the maximum output of heat, which will warm a room up to 5m by 5m. This is more than enough to keep your family and you cozy throughout winter.

Some bio ethanol fireplaces have a remote control, giving you full control of the flame and heat from the comfort of your couch. This feature is especially useful if you have young children or pets in the house. It is also possible to install bio-ethanol fireplaces into the wall. The majority of these designs come with extensions and brackets, allowing them to be mounted to an unfinished or sloped wall.

There is no smoke or ash

Ethanol fires do not produce smoke or ash, making them safe to use anywhere. They are also much easier to operate than traditional wood burning fireplaces, which often require a chimney and flue and can cause issues like chimney fires. Chimney fires can be a significant concern because they can cause expensive damages to your home as well as health problems for family members, especially children and elderly people.

Bioethanol fires burn cleanly, so it produces no harmful byproducts and doesn't generate carbon monoxide, which can be deadly. The flames are beautiful and give a unique look to any space. You can put up an ethanol-based fireplace that is mounted on the wall to save space in your office or at home.

In order to operate a bio ethanol-based fire, you need to use the correct lighting rod and refill it using the appropriate fuel. Be sure to cover the burner with a lid and close the lid after you're done. You can make use of the tool that came with the burner to accomplish this, or use the hook at the rod's end to lift the outer lid. Be sure to keep it closed and empty for at least 60 minutes prior refilling.

When you're ready for more fuel, the simplest way is to use the rod to dip into the tank and refill the reservoir. Make sure to store your equipment for refueling in a secure location out of reach from kids and pets. No carbon monoxide

Bioethanol, unlike wood, propane gas and other types of fireplace fuels, doesn't emit carbon monoxide, or other harmful substances when it is burned. This is due to the fact that bio ethanol burns completely, leaving only water and heat. But, this doesn't mean that you can rely on an ethanol fire as your primary source of heat. It's still essential to have an alternative source of heat.

There are many styles of bio ethanol fireplaces, including wall fires-mounted and recessed models. Some look like open fires or stoves, while others are modern and sleek. Some models can be used both indoors and outdoors. They are ideal for homes that have been renovated and do not have a chimney or a flue or for new homes without chimneys or flues.

Some ethanol fireplaces come with a built-in heater, while others have a separate heater that can be attached to the firebox. The burners can be manual or automated, but each type has its own advantages and drawbacks. In general, automatic burners are more convenient as they switch off and on automatically and provide more control over the flame. They also work better than manual burners that require the use of a lighter to begin.

When selecting an ethanol fire it is important to think about the dimensions of your space and the way you intend to make use of it. Smaller fires are great as an accent piece, whereas larger ones can provide significant warmth. It's also important to choose a model that's easy to maintain and use. Easy to install

Ethanol Fireplaces are easy-to-install. They don't require a chimney or flue, and can be installed anywhere, including inside your home or in a shed. The fuel burns cleanly, which means there's no smoke or ash. The indoor air pollution is also low. They're also more affordable than traditional wood-burning stoves.

Bio ethanol fires are also simple to operate. Pour a small amount of fuel into the burner to ignite it. You can control the size of the flame with the regulator rod. You can extinguish a fire by placing the lid on top of the opening.

Most bio ethanol fires come with some form of remote control, which gives you the ultimate flexibility and control over your fireplace. Most models also include an efficient ash bucket to remove embers and reduce the chance of sparks.

Easy to operate

Ethanol fires are very simple to operate. Add fuel and then turn on the fire. The majority of models have a remote for maximum convenience.

These fireplaces are perfect for making your home feel cozy, warm and inviting without the negative side effects that are associated with traditional fireplaces electric. They are an excellent alternative to gas fires, as they have no chimney and produce very little pollution. They are also safe for people with allergies or respiratory issues because they don't emit carbon monoxide or smoke.

Additionally the fireplaces that are ethanol can also be customised to fit your unique aesthetic preferences. They can be constructed in a variety of designs, from transparent glass to shiny steel, or matte black. Those who prefer more of traditional appearance can incorporate a false flue for an authentic appearance. They can be complemented with different design elements and features, including decorative log sets, protective fire screens, and stainless steel lids.

They can be easily moved from one room to another. They are lightweight and don't require an additional fireplace. Certain models can be used indoors and out. They are the ideal choice for those who just moved into a new home or had their chimney breast removed.

The flames of these fireplaces can last up to four hours, and are easy to put out. The majority of fireplaces have lids or tools that can be used to reduce the flame size or extinguish it completely. It is not recommended to refill your ethanol fire right away after it has been put out. This can cause the fire to overflow and possibly cause the destruction of your home!
